#667fb9 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#667fb9 is composed of 40% red, 49.8% green and 72.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 44.9% cyan, 31.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 27.5% black. It has a hue angle of 221.9 degrees, a saturation of 37.2% and a lightness of 56.3%. #667fb9 color hex could be obtained by blending #ccfeff with #000073. Closest websafe color is: #6666cc.

#667fb9 color description : Slightly desaturated blue.

#667fb9 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#667fb9 has RGB values of R:102, G:127, B:185 and CMYK values of C:0.45, M:0.31, Y:0, K:0.27. Its decimal value is 6717369.

Shades and Tints of #667fb9

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040508 is the darkest color, while #fafbfd is the lightest one.
